Israel: After ceasefire with Hezbollah, ultimate goal is hostage release, says Israel Kats

The Israeli army said it had struck "dozens" of Hezbollah targets in Beirut and the south of the country before a ceasefire took effect early this morning

Newsroom November 27 02:01

Δείτε περισσότερα άρθρα μας στα αποτελέσματα αναζήτησης

Add Protothema.gr on Google

After a ceasefire with Hezbollah went into effect early this morning in Lebanon, Israeli Defense Minister Israel Kats said that the “ultimate goal” is the release of hostages still being held in the Gaza Strip.

“The results of the campaign in the north will put additional pressure on the (Palestinian organization) Hamas, Katz said in a speech in Tel Aviv. Israel “will make every effort necessary to create the conditions for a new hostage exchange and bring all the people (back) home,” he added, saying he saw this as “the most important moral purpose and the ultimate goal.”

Meanwhile, the Israeli military said it struck “dozens” of Hezbollah targets in Beirut and the south of the country before a ceasefire in Lebanon took effect early this morning.

“Before the start of the ceasefire, the Israeli Air Force conducted, based on intelligence information, strikes against dozens of Hezbollah command centers, launchers, weapons depots, and terrorist infrastructure facilities in Beirut, Tyre, and Nabatiya, the military said in a statement.
